Image Processing Software Engineer

Job Details

Image Processing Software Engineer

Ottawa, Ontario




Job Description

Region: National Capital Region

Employment Type: Contract

Security Clearance: Secret (Level 2)

Language Requirements: English

Job Reference Number: 37151 - EH


Project Description:

Founded in 1967, we are a privately owned and operated Canadian company with a strong culture of commitment, trust and transparency. We harness the best and brightest minds to provide tailored solutions whilst creating unique avenues for continued professional development.

We are guided by a set of ethical values of Respect, Loyalty and Trust and a commitment to excellence, which define us and guide our organizational conduct.

We are currently looking a Software Engineer - Intermediate for one of our opportunities in the National Capital Region.



As an Intermediate Software Engineer, you will provide software maintenance and support services to DND for all operational simulation units permanently installed at three sites. This work will also include support for the test unit installed at Carleton University in the National Capital Region.


The successful candidate shall deliver the following:

  • Updated source code in the form of fault patches as necessary;
  • Any changes made to software documentation, user documentation, and training packages.
  • Up-to-date repository listings, including an annual inventory; and
  • Monthly Issue Report.

The successful candidate will also perform software maintenance and support. This work shall include:

  • Assist operational staff with rework and retesting of software testing scenarios;
  • Documentation updates;
  • Updates to training materials, including the on-line integrated information and learning environment training package for IOS operators; and
  • Offsite software backup on an external hard drive of the software each time a software patch or modification is rolled out.


Requirements (experience/skills/clearance):

  • Must have a Bachelor’s Degree or better in Sciences, Engineering, Computer Science, or Mathematics, with Modeling and Simulation courses.
  • A minimum of three (3) years in the past five (5) years designing, coding, and testing C++ and Java programming in a modeling and simulation environment
  • A minimum of four (4) years in the past ten (10) years working in a Microsoft, and Unix or Linux operating system environment.
  • A minimum of two (2) years in the past five (5) years developing HLA compliant simulation systems.
  • A minimum of four (4) years in the past ten (10) years working with Image Generation and display systems.


 Other Requirements:

  • A minimum of two project references from previous clients is required where the candidate performed software development or maintenance duties in the past ten (10) years is considered an asset.


Additional Comments:

Are you an ADGA employee or consultant? If so, check out our new referral program!

ADGA Group Consultants Inc. has policies and procedures in place to support its employees with accommodation requirements throughout the organization.

Accommodations are available on request for candidates taking part in all aspects of the selection process. If accommodation is required, it is requested that you contact ADGA’s Accessibility Officer.

© 2018, Bond International Software, Inc. All rights reserved.

Version 4.4.0